void protocols::simple_moves::sidechain_moves::SidechainMoverBase::idealize_sidechains | ( | core::pose::Pose & | pose | ) |
idealize sidechains that might be altered
all sidechains that might be changed are replaced with ideal coordinates that have the original chi angles

void protocols::simple_moves::sidechain_moves::SidechainMoverBase::init_task | ( | core::pose::Pose const & | pose | ) |
initialize the packer task if necessary
Check to make sure that a packer task exists and matches the numer of residues in the given pose. If that isn't the case, create a new one with the task factory. Exits with an error if no task factory exists.
